在MySQL中SET类型的数据

分类:知识百科 日期: 点击:0

MySQL中的SET类型数据是一种特殊的数据类型,它可以存储一组具有特定顺序的值。它由一组字符串值组成,每个字符串值都是唯一的,并且是按照特定顺序存储的。它的最大长度是64个字符,每个字符串的最大长度是255个字符。

SET类型数据的使用方法:

1. 在创建表时,可以使用SET类型来定义一个字段,例如:

CREATE TABLE tablename (
    fieldname SET('value1', 'value2', 'value3')
);

2. 在插入数据时,可以使用SET类型,例如:

INSERT INTO tablename (fieldname)
VALUES('value1,value2');

3. 在更新数据时,可以使用SET类型,例如:

UPDATE tablename
SET fieldname = 'value1,value2'
WHERE id = 1;

4. 在查询数据时,可以使用SET类型,例如:

SELECT *
FROM tablename
WHERE fieldname LIKE '%value1%';

SET类型数据的优点是可以存储一组有序的值,而不是一个值,这样可以更好地满足复杂的需求。它的字符串值也是唯一的,这样可以确保数据的完整性和准确性。

标签:

版权声明

1. 本站所有素材,仅限学习交流,仅展示部分内容,如需查看完整内容,请下载原文件。
2. 会员在本站下载的所有素材,只拥有使用权,著作权归原作者所有。
3. 所有素材,未经合法授权,请勿用于商业用途,会员不得以任何形式发布、传播、复制、转售该素材,否则一律封号处理。
4. 如果素材损害你的权益请联系客服QQ:77594475 处理。